diff options
Diffstat (limited to 'Build/source/texk/dvisvgm/dvisvgm-src/src/utility.cpp')
-rw-r--r-- | Build/source/texk/dvisvgm/dvisvgm-src/src/utility.cpp |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/Build/source/texk/dvisvgm/dvisvgm-src/src/utility.cpp b/Build/source/texk/dvisvgm/dvisvgm-src/src/utility.cpp index f702d67ce54..56f2c17ae7c 100644 --- a/Build/source/texk/dvisvgm/dvisvgm-src/src/utility.cpp +++ b/Build/source/texk/dvisvgm/dvisvgm-src/src/utility.cpp @@ -2,7 +2,7 @@ ** utility.cpp ** ** ** ** This file is part of dvisvgm -- a fast DVI to SVG converter ** -** Copyright (C) 2005-2021 Martin Gieseking <martin.gieseking@uos.de> ** +** Copyright (C) 2005-2022 Martin Gieseking <martin.gieseking@uos.de> ** ** ** ** This program is free software; you can redistribute it and/or ** ** modify it under the terms of the GNU General Public License as ** @@ -134,17 +134,17 @@ string util::replace (string str, const string &find, const string &repl) { vector<string> util::split (const string &str, const string &sep) { vector<string> parts; if (str.empty() || sep.empty()) - parts.emplace_back(str); + parts.push_back(str); else { size_t left=0; while (left <= str.length()) { size_t right = str.find(sep, left); if (right == string::npos) { - parts.emplace_back(str.substr(left)); + parts.push_back(str.substr(left)); left = string::npos; } else { - parts.emplace_back(str.substr(left, right-left)); + parts.push_back(str.substr(left, right-left)); left = right+sep.length(); } } |